Chris is Astley Vineyard’s winemaker, and also manages our sales, trade customersevents and online.

​From an early age, Chris knew he was passionate about food & drink. A career in the music industry was quickly followed by a move to his current industry. ​It was his job at Harvey Nichols' wineshop that cemented his future in wine.

A passion for wine & beer was converted to formal knowledge and experience under his excellent mentor and boss. Sadly, a promotion to their buying team was rejected due to his lack of WSET at this point, so that is exactly what he got next.

WSET Level 3 (Distinction), a Plumpton College winemaking course, and simply the opportunity (and desire) to experiment cemented the skills he uses today.

​Innovation & experimentation are increasingly applied across our boutique range of wines. Interest is prized above tradition; which has since awarded us places on Michelin Star wine lists across the country. He has also been a judge at wine competitions and public speaker at numerous public events.
